Additional Description

Roles & Responsibilities

• Develop in-depth understanding of GMPI business and its operations.

• Be responsible for the products/services categories and product assortment (both regular, seasonal and special edition).

• Provide strategy and implementation roadmap for merchandise and lifestyle package, including principles, guidelines, contents, and GTM launch plans.

• Define and monitor product key focus and work closely with the Digital Retail Manager to achieve the sales target.

• Monitoring and maximizing the profitability and assisting in putting together the P&L.

• Utilizing the knowledge of ID (Industry Design)/PD (Product Design), production and pricing, to manage and troubleshoot issues with related internal/external stakeholders and present solutions.

• Work closely with TP agency on the daily basis to ensure implementations and executions are delivered consistently with the planned stores operational plans and timelines. Closely monitor orders tracking with Digital Retail Manager to ensure complete timely and quality fulfillment of all orders.

• Work very closely with Marketing teams to on alignment of the SKUs’ design and production quality.

• Monitor and manage seasonal stock level and work closely with Digital Retail Manager to forecast the sales and probability of all merchandise and lifestyle packages. Forecast and maintain appropriate inventory level maintenance. Prepare timely stock requisition.

• Work very closely with Marketing teams to develop strategic, customer-centric promotion plans. Cocreate the required content and management/maintenance of the accuracy/compliance content.

• Work closely with the Customer Experience (CX) team on the timely updates on the respective consumer digital journeys and MOTs in order to react timely to the consumers’ sweet spots in terms of strategy, plan and executions.

• Liaise with internal support/service functions (i.e. Legal, Finance, Purchase, Cyber Security, etc) and external vendors (e.g. TP agency, platforms, vendors, etc) to ensure the stores are operating to achieve the operations and business targets in transparent and efficient way.

• Conduct standard operations process review, and on-going operation working process initiation and optimization.

• Create package offers with compelling experience and services for each customer segments. Continually drive innovation and create memorable digital shopping experiences.

• Drive new revenue streams and commercial services value propositions through pilot programs and capture learnings to refine expansion plans.

• Be the voice of customers to advocate for improvement plans in product/service offerings, roadmap and customer shopping experience.

• Define business value KPIs and monitor ROI to prove values of product and experience offerings.

• Lead to compile and present timely daily/weekly/monthly/bi-annual/annual stores performance review reports with insights, learnings and optimization action plans. Mange both quantitative and qualitative analysis, analyzing all sales performance and competitor analysis.

• Lead market analytics to understand market trends identifying the next growth opportunities or to address business needs. Regular and ad-hoc market update or competition report required and on demand. Research and analyze product and services trends by keeping up-to-date with the latest offerings from the market (both local inland and international) and coordinating with both internal and external stakeholders to create demand generation and new sales opportunities.
